The Bachelor’s degree in International Studies at Lander University provides a comprehensive understanding of global issues, cultures, and interconnected economies. The course covers a wide array of topics, including international relations, global security, human rights, and environmental challenges. Students engage in critical analysis of geopolitical dynamics and cultural interrelations, preparing them for a globally interconnected world.
The program is structured to combine theoretical learning with practical application. Students will participate in internships, study abroad programs, and collaborative projects that enhance their understanding of global affairs. A diverse curriculum allows for the exploration of different regions and cultures, equipping students with the ability to approach complex international issues from multiple perspectives.
Skills gained include critical thinking, cross-cultural communication, research proficiency, and an understanding of international law and policy. To enroll in the Bachelor’s degree in International Studies, students typically need to have completed their secondary education with a strong academic record. A background in social sciences, languages, or humanities can be beneficial. Admissions may also require personal statements or letters of recommendation to demonstrate motivation and readiness for university studies.
Non-native English speakers are generally required to demonstrate English language proficiency through standardized tests such as TOEFL or IELTS. Typically, an overall score of 6.5 in IELTS or 79 in TOEFL is expected, with no individual score lower than a designated minimum.
International students need to ensure they have valid passports and may require additional documentation such as transcripts and proof of financial support.
